WebHomophones are tricky, they can be misunderstood when they are spoken, the listener can misinterpret the words. Homo means “of the same kind” and Phone means “Voice” in English you can use the word pronunciation, so homophones mean the words having the same pronunciation – they can be two or more than two e.g. hair, hear hare, and even heir. Web1 dag geleden · homophone in British English (ˈhɒməˌfəʊn ) noun 1. one of a group of words pronounced in the same way but differing in meaning or spelling or both, as for example bear and bare 2. a written letter or combination of letters that represents the same speech sound as another 'ph' is a homophone of 'f' in English Collins English Dictionary.
